Nwam LLC Reduces Barrick Mining Holdings by 47.3% Amid Market Adjustments
Nwam LLC has significantly reduced its stake in Barrick Mining Corporation, cutting its holdings by 47.3% during the third quarter of 2024. According to a report from HoldingsChannel, the investment firm sold 10,561 shares, leaving it with 11,788 shares valued at approximately $372,000 based on its most recent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) filing. This decision reflects broader trends among hedge funds adjusting their positions in the gold and copper producer.
Several other investment firms have also modified their stakes in Barrick Mining. Ascent Group LLC increased its holdings by 2.9%, now owning 14,514 shares worth around $476,000 after acquiring an additional 404 shares. Meanwhile, Nexus Investment Management ULC raised its stake by 39.4%, bringing its total to 2,300 shares valued at $75,000, following the purchase of 650 shares during the same period.
Additionally, Hedges Asset Management LLC expanded its holdings by 1.7%, now owning 61,000 shares worth nearly $1.999 million after acquiring 1,000 shares. Fruth Investment Management also reported a 5.3% increase, resulting in a total of 19,800 shares valued at $648,000. Lastly, Investors Research Corp entered the fray by purchasing a new stake worth $36,000. Notably, hedge funds and institutional investors control approximately 90.82% of Barrick Mining’s stock.
Market Performance and Dividend Increase
As of Friday, Barrick Mining’s stock opened at $48.68. The company’s market capitalization stands at $81.56 billion, with a price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io of 23.52 and a price-to-earnings-growth (PEG) ratio of 0.41. The stock’s beta is measured at 0.41, indicating lower volatility compared to the broader market. Barrick Mining has seen a 52-week low of $15.47 and a 52-week high of $50.51. The company reported a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.14, a current ratio of 2.94, and a quick ratio of 2.33.
In a positive development for shareholders, Barrick Mining announced a quarterly dividend of $0.175, which was paid on December 15, 2024. Shareholders recorded as of November 28, 2024, received this dividend, reflecting an increase from the previous quarterly dividend of $0.15. This translates to an annualized dividend of $0.70 and a dividend yield of 1.4%. The dividend payout ratio stands at 33.82%, indicating a sustainable return to investors.
Analyst Opinions and Future Outlook
Market analysts are actively weighing in on Barrick Mining’s prospects. Jefferies Financial Group reaffirmed a “buy” rating with a target price of $55.00 as of December 7, 2024. Raymond James Financial recently adjusted its price target from $40.00 to $42.00, maintaining an “outperform” rating. Additionally, BNP Paribas upgraded the stock to a “neutral” rating with a price objective of $50.00.
Weiss Ratings reiterated a “buy (b)” rating, while Wall Street Zen downgraded the stock from a “strong-buy” to a “buy” rating. Currently, two analysts have rated Barrick Mining with a “Strong Buy,” seventeen have given it a “Buy,” and three have issued a “Hold” rating. According to MarketBeat, the stock has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” with a target price of $47.17.
Barrick Mining Corporation, headquartered in Toronto, focuses on the exploration, development, production, and sale of gold and copper. The company operates large-scale mining complexes and processing facilities, encompassing the entire mining value chain from exploration to closure and reclamation.
